色婷婷狠狠18禁久久YY,CHINESE性内射高清国产,国产女人18毛片水真多1,国产AV在线观看

mysql 建表默認字符集

洪振霞2年前10瀏覽0評論

MySQL是一個廣泛應用于互聯網服務的關系型數據庫管理系統。在創建表時,我們需要指定表的默認字符集,以保證正確存儲和讀取數據。

MySQL支持多種字符集,例如utf8、gbk和latin1等等。在建表時,通過設置DEFAULT CHARSET參數可以指定表的默認字符集。

CREATE TABLE example_table (
example_id INT NOT NULL AUTO_INCREMENT,
example_text VARCHAR(50) NOT NULL,
PRIMARY KEY (example_id)
) DEFAULT CHARSET=utf8;

在上面的例子中,我們通過DEFAULT CHARSET參數指定了表的默認字符集為utf8。

需要注意的是,MySQL的默認字符集是latin1,如果不指定DEFAULT CHARSET參數,則表會使用該字符集。

同時,當表內數據量較大時,字符集的選擇也會影響性能。例如,utf8mb4是utf8的改進版,可以支持更廣泛的字符集,但對于大型表而言,存儲和讀取utf8mb4格式的數據可能會顯著減緩響應速度。

因此,在建表時需要根據實際需求和數據量來選擇合適的字符集。